## Service Accounts — Cron Drift Investigation

The drift probe runs under the svc-cronwatch account. It compares scheduled vs. actual fire times across the Pellet cluster and writes deltas to the Tallyline service. Do not reuse this account elsewhere; scope is read-only on scheduler state. Rotate quarterly. The probe authenticates to Tallyline with the key below.

app token of yajeg-kawef = kto11_7En3XSX8xQw

Changelog — Ledgerline Report Builder 2.9

Heads up, new folks: we renamed SORT_STABLE_MODE to REPORTS_STABLE_SORT. Same behavior — it keeps row order deterministic when two rows tie on the sort key, which is why the Quarterly Margins report stopped shuffling between runs. The old name silently did nothing after the Fernhook refactor, which is how the flakiness snuck back in. While you're editing the env file anyway, the stable-sort worker also needs its signing credential set on the very next line. Right after the rename, add:

sealed setting: VAULT_KEY20=69e2a0b23f1a79fbf692

Context for this week's sync: the Marrowgate build fleet showed intermittent test failures traced to clock skew between agents in the Telfer and Quarry pools. The Skewsense daemon now enforces a 200ms tolerance and quarantines drifting agents automatically. To pull skew reports from the Skewsense service yourself, authenticate with the internal key included below.

API key for fahip-kahip: zpat23_XiJGUHz5xfaAtaIqUkus0rh